NEW YORK, NY, UNITED STATES, February 23, 2026 /EINPresswire.com/ -- Crisis Text Line, a global nonprofit organization that provides free, 24/7, confidential text-based mental health support in both English and Spanish, recently announced its Board of Directors for 2026. The board brings together leaders across technology, healthcare, research, philanthropy, business, and social impact to guide the organization’s continued growth and global impact.— Dena Trujillo, CEO of Crisis Text Line
“Our Board of Directors brings a wealth of crucial experience as we continue to work towards sustainable growth on a global level,” said Dena Trujillo, CEO of Crisis Text Line. “Their expertise and commitment help us continue to innovate responsibly while staying grounded in human connection.”
The 2026 Board will support Crisis Text Line as it scales volunteer-powered support, advances responsible use of AI, drives evidence-based research, and strengthens partnerships to meet rising demand for mental health care in the United States and around the world.

About Crisis Text Line
Crisis Text Line is a global mental health organization dedicated to supporting people in their most difficult moments. The nonprofit focuses on both crisis intervention and prevention, providing free, 24/7, confidential support in English and Spanish through a text-based platform that meets people where they are. Since its launch in 2013, Crisis Text Line has supported over 12 million conversations in the United States and more than 17 million globally together with our affiliates in Canada, the UK and Ireland. Crisis Text Line’s 120,000 trained volunteer Crisis Counselors bring texters from a hot moment to a cool calm by empowering each texter to use their own strengths and coping strategies.
